i see they have a clinical trial going at sloan-kettering in ny. it is a vaccine to help prevent sclc from returning. i will be getting in this trial when my treatment is over in a few months. hey..ya never know it just might work....they have had a good response on the immune system on the first trial. do not know if they are doing this in any other part of the country but may be worth finding out....good luck to all....we all can BEAT this thing!!!!!!!!!!!!!!

I tried getting in on this last year --- but I was too far away from my last chemo. I think you have to be no more than 6 weeks from your last chemo --- and cannot be on steroids. Hurry and call Sloan !!!!!

they want you at least 4 weeks from your last treatment and no more than 12 weeks since last treatment. my dr knows the dr at sloan so i shouldn't have a problem getting in.....i hope...
